NZ vs UAE Pitch Report

The M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ai typically offers a batting-friendly pitch, especially at the start of a game. Batsmen can expect true bounce and consistent pace, allowing for aggressive stroke play. In T20 matches, scores in the first innings often reach 160-180+, with the boundaries being of moderate size, enabling big hits.

As the game progresses, the pitch may slow down slightly, providing some assistance to spinners during the middle overs. However, accuracy and variations will be crucial for success over extreme turn. Fast bowlers may find some movement early on but will need to rely on cutters and slower deliveries as the innings progress.

In day-night encounters, dew could make bowling in the second innings challenging, potentially giving the chasing team an advantage. Overall, the MA Chidambaram Stadium promises a balanced contest between bat and ball, with early batting prowess and intelligent spin bowling often determining the outcome.
